Victor Wanyama's Days With Southampton Might Be Numbered



Victor Wanyama has made as many headlines this season for time spent in the stands as for his efforts on the pitch and the Southampton midfielder may have to get used to watching from the sidelines thanks to the impressive form of deputy Oriol Romeu.

Wanyama was left out by manager Ronald Koeman for the 3-0 win over Norwich in September after claiming he was "not mentally fit to play," after demanding Southampton sanctioned a move to Tottenham -- a request that was flatly 
turned down.

The former Celtic powerhouse found himself back in Koeman's bad books after picking up his second red card of the season in the corresponding fixture at Carrow Road; a 1-0 defeat earlier this month that triggered a two-match suspension.

His punishment served, Wanyama is available for selection for Saturday's vital visit of West Brom, but Koeman would be either brave or foolish to bring him straight back into the team after Romeu's efforts during the African's absence. [Source]
